Jun 24, 2020 · the protagonist… they represent a complete change, the “death” of the former self, which is why the antagonist resists them. If your protagonist doesn’t have their self-identity shaken to its roots, you need to make this scene bigger. This is the first major interaction with the antagonist or the forces of evil.
